A HORRIFIED mum who bought a new dress online found period stains in the lining.

Sacha Brown, 38, said she was "livid" when she discovered her £8 bargain from Pretty Little Thing was soiled with blood.

She quickly washed her hands several times after taking delivery of the white lace bodycon dress on Monday — bought ahead of a holiday to St Lucia with her son next week.

Nail technician Sasha, from Surbiton, South West London, told The Sun Online: "I'm going on holiday next Monday with my nine-year-old son to St Lucia in the Caribbean.

"I decided to order some new clothes from Pretty Little Things online to take on holiday with me.

"Among the items was a white lace bodycon dress reduced to £8.

"The dress arrived this afternoon and I opened it up to take a look at it and make sure it fits before packing it away.

"But when I looked at the lining I noticed three large blood stains — I was like, 'What the actual f***'.

"I am livid. I could not believe what I was seeing."

She had picked up her clothing from the popular clothes site - which targets women aged 16 to 34.

It has gone on to become one of the biggest names in online fashion since its launch six years ago, with its clothes modelled by superstars like Kourtney Kardashian.

But South Londoner Sasha was less than impressed with her shopping experience.

She added: "I am absolutely convinced it is blood stains from a period. As a woman, you know these things when you see them.

"Someone has obviously ordered the dress and tried it on without wearing underwear or a pad before sending it back.

"Who would do something like that? I just think it's so disgusting.

"I washed my hands four times after.

"This is my first bad experience with Pretty Little Thing. The prices are reasonable — I just wanted a few cheap things to take on holiday with me.

"But now I would seriously reconsider shopping with them ever again.

"They have exposed me to someone else's blood — I expect compensation. I am very upset."

A spokesperson for Pretty Little Thing said: "We’re really sorry to hear Sacha has received her item this way. Our customer service team have contacted Sacha and she has been issued a full refund on her order and we’ll be looking further into this."
